Output 42c156f258a4983d9c728d315dbaafe6d0eca7f94bfe0f71ebbef9e52166d50c:1

value
13980
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d8d2de5b3d6d77272a801a31a497cb9a16172b0 OP_EQUAL
address
3ADfth8hFAHQ4ELtUYddnTt3nw8ZQF3kWf
transaction
42c156f258a4983d9c728d315dbaafe6d0eca7f94bfe0f71ebbef9e52166d50c
spent
true